BMW Replacement Key Fob: Your Comprehensive Guide
BMW automobiles are commemorated for their high-end, engineering excellence, and innovative technology. However, as sophisticated as these cars and trucks are, their key fobs can in some cases become lost, harmed, or breakdown, leaving owners dealing with the inconvenience of requiring a replacement. This article looks into whatever you require to understand about BMW Key Replacement replacement key fobs, consisting of types, costs, and the replacement procedure.
Understanding BMW Key Fobs
BMW key fobs operate utilizing a combination of RFID technology and remote control functions. There are normally two kinds of key fobs utilized in BMW Replacement Key cars:

The BMW key fob is not just a remote; it's loaded with functions designed to enhance the chauffeur's experience. Here are some notable functionalities:

There are various factors why a BMW Replacement Keys owner may require a replacement key fob. Here are some common situations:

Replacing a BMW key fob is not as easy as obtaining a generic fob. BMW key fobs are specifically designed for each design, and they utilize advanced technology, which typically requires programming. Here are the steps to follow:
1. Identify Your Key Fob Type
Before replacing your key fob, it's necessary to understand which type you need. Utilize the following table to identify your key fob based on your BMW model:

There are usually 3 alternatives for obtaining a replacement key fob:

Programming a new key fob can typically be done through the dealership or a professional locksmith. Here's a basic overview of the programming procedure:
Via Dealership:
Bring your vehicle and proof of ownership.The dealership will use specific equipment to set the new fob to your car's onboard computer.
Via Locksmith:

The cost of a BMW replacement key fob differs based on a number of factors, including type and where you source it. Here's a breakdown of possible expenses:
SourceEstimated Cost RangeBMW Dealership₤ 300 - ₤ 800Third-Party Locksmith₤ 150 - ₤ 350Online Purchase₤ 50 - ₤ 200 (omitting programming)
Note: Prices can fluctuate based on the design of the car and any additional features.
FAQ1. The length of time will it take to replace my BMW key fob?
The replacement procedure can take anywhere from 30 minutes to a few days, depending on whether you're going through a dealership or a locksmith and the availability of the key fob.
2. Can I program a BMW key fob myself?
For the majority of BMW designs, self-programming is not possible due to the requirement for specific equipment. It's recommended to look for professional aid.
3. What should I do if my key fob quits working?
If your key fob stops working, the initial step is to replace the battery. If it still does not work, you might need to think about a replacement.
4. Is it possible to get a replacement key fob without the initial?
Obtaining a replacement key fob without the original can be made complex, as evidence of ownership is normally required.
5. Are all BMW key fobs the same?
No, BMW key fobs differ by model and year, so it's essential to guarantee you have the appropriate one for your car.
